The Value of Routine Pruning

Consistent pruning goes beyond improving aesthetics-it decreases structural problems, clears diseased or crossing branches, and improves wind-load distribution to reduce failure risk during storms. You'll additionally manage clearance over roofs, walkways, and utilities, minimizing contact points that create abrasion and decay. Proper canopy thinning enhances light and air penetration, lowering leaf wetness duration and presence of foliar pathogens. Proper branch spacing and selective cuts support stronger attachment angles, minimizing co-dominant stems and future splitting. Timing is important: prune during dormancy or after peak growth flush to minimize stress and pest attraction. Implement ANSI A300 standards and well-maintained, sanitized tools to create small, clean wounds outside the branch collar. With periodic intervals, you extend service life, maintain form, and prevent costly emergency interventions.

Safety Assessment Protocols

Pruning defines the structure; safety analysis ensures that foundation holds up securely under actual conditions. You initiate with a methodical assessment protocol: botanical identification, trunk size, crown architecture, flaws (cracks, voids, multiple trunks), root zone status, tilt degree, and usage area below. You document with photos, caliper readings, and acoustic tests. For high-value sites, you incorporate advanced diagnostic tools to measure wood deterioration and evaluate remaining solid wood.

Next, you implement a risk matrix that combines failure probability with impact severity, taking into account Sarasota's environmental factors and ground composition. You afterwards outline risk reduction strategies: canopy reduction measurements, cabling/bracing specs (ANSI A300), clearance pruning near utilities, or complete removal for unacceptable risk levels. Finally, you schedule reinspection intervals aligned with growth rates and storm seasons.

Recognizing Hazardous Trees

Even if a tree appears healthy, particular indicators can indicate a high risk of failure and potential damage. Begin your inspection at the base: watch for heaving roots, new soil mounds, or compromised root systems-frequently occurring after building projects or major storms. Examine the root flare for deterioration and be alert for fungal growths or unusual odors. Survey the trunk for new bark splits, leaking sap, or sudden angle changes following heavy rainfall.

Evaluate the canopy with restricted visibility by using binoculars at different viewpoints and varying daylight hours. Yellowed leaves outside normal seasons, sparse foliage, or multiple dead twigs suggest tree stress. Monitor tree deterioration subsequent to watering changes or exposure to salt. Log results, photograph changes, and arrange a qualified arborist's Level 2 visual inspection, especially before the hurricane season.

Structural Defects Explained

Although trees may look robust, hidden structural issues can mask important vulnerabilities that elevate the probability of falling when exposed to storms, precipitation, or saturated ground. Look out for tightly joined codominant branches, bark inclusions, and structural splits. Trunk hollows, lengthwise fissures, and notable angles indicate compromised load paths. In the crown, dying branches indicate overall health issues or circulation disruption. At the root collar, irregular buttress roots, decay bodies, and soil displacement indicate root problems or anchoring concerns. Bark death, seeping sap, and cutting injuries can harbor internal decay. Local soil conditions and periodic saturation intensify weaknesses by weakening tree stability and adding pressure to weakened branches. Note visible defects, identify potential targets under the canopy, and schedule assessments after major storms.

Professional Pruning, Trimming Strategies, and Growth Maintenance

Because proper cuts shape structure and reduce risk, you approach precision pruning with clear objectives, correct timing, and clean technique. You locate target branches at the collar and branch bark ridge, then make three-cut removals to prevent tearing. You emphasize crown balancing to distribute weight and optimize wind handling, using selective thinning to minimize density without excessive interior clearing. You retain scaffold hierarchy, maintain 30-45% live crown ratio on shade trees, and respect species-specific responses common in Sarasota-live oak, laurel oak, and sable palm.

The best time to prune is during dormancy or post-flush hardening to minimize stress, making sure to sanitize tools between trees, and limiting annual canopy removal to 20-25%. Avoid damaging techniques such as topping, flush cuts, and excessive raise-pruning that leads to weak sprouts. Make sure to document defects, track regrowth, and create maintenance intervals.

Professional Tree Removal and Stump Grinding Guidelines

Although tree removal is a final option, you proceed with a hazard-first mentality: complete a comprehensive risk assessment (analyzing targets, lean, defects, decay class), verify how different species typically fail common in Sarasota winds, and establish drop zones and safety boundaries. Pick the method - crane, rigging, or sectional dismantling - depending on load paths, tie-in points, and canopy weight distribution. Conduct pre-job briefings to align roles, hand signals, and escape routes. Emphasize crew training in chainsaw handling, aerial lift rescue, and rigging physics. Require PPE: safety helmet, hearing/eye protection, protective chaps and ANSI Z133-compliant climbing systems. Plan equipment maintenance; inspect ropes, carabiners, saw chain tension, and hydraulic lines before operation. For stump grinding, locate utilities, set up shields, contain chips, and confirm proper backfill and grade.

Important Permits, Regulations, and Insurance to Verify

Before starting any tree work in Sarasota, you must follow specific regulations, so be sure to check required permissions, protected species classifications, and right-of-way limitations before beginning work. Initially verify permits using Sarasota County's ePermit system or your municipal authority; record species of trees, diameter at breast height (DBH), and placement in setbacks or coastal zones. Make sure to verify exemptions (such as immediate danger confirmed by professional assessment) before proceeding. Examine Florida's protected and invasive species listings to prevent infractions.

Confirm contractor licensure and OSHA compliance. Secure written proof of insurance: current general liability for tree work, workers' compensation, and commercial vehicle insurance. Request certificates to be issued directly from the insurer designating you as the certificate holder and confirming coverage limits and endorsements (CG 20 10/20 37 where applicable). Check utility line clearances with 811 and secure HOA permission where required.
